Crimson squash players open their in-when nine members of the team play Dartmouth. Meanwhile the Yardling acketman take on St. Paul's at 3 p.m. Hemenway Gym.
Varsity captain Jim Bacon will be number one in the absence of Charlie Ford, who is playing soccer today, and aggsy Mugaseth is number two. Dave names is third, and Altie Flagg fourtn. Dave Watts, regular three-man, will start number five because of an injured thumb, followed by Larry Brownell,
